내부 스키마가 바뀌어도 개념·응용 SQL은 안 흔들린다
물리적 독립성 — 내부 → 개념 보호
물리적 독립성
내부 스키마(저장 구조)가 변경돼도 개념 스키마·응용 SQL은 영향 없음. 변경 사건 = 디스크 교체(HDD↔SSD)·인덱스 변경(B-Tree↔Hash)·파티셔닝. (이커머스가 디스크를 NVMe SSD로 통째 교체해도 SQL 무수정)
| 구분 | 논리적 독립성 | 물리적 독립성 |
| 보호 방향 | 개념 → 외부 (위쪽) | 내부 → 개념 (아래쪽) |
| 변경 사건 | 컬럼 추가·자료형 (DDL) | 디스크·인덱스·파티셔닝 |
| 안 흔들림 | 응용·뷰 코드 | 응용 SQL·개념 스키마 |
합격 한 줄
논리적 = 위쪽 보호(개념→외부) / 물리적 = 아래쪽 보호(내부→개념). 외부가 위(사용자 가까이), 내부가 아래(저장 매체 가까이) — 방향 뒤집기 함정은 이 한 쌍으로 분별.